Systematic name YMR288W
Gene name HSH155
Aliases
Feature type ORF, Verified
Coordinates Chr XIII:845571..848486
Primary SGDID S000004901


Description of YMR288W: U2-snRNP associated splicing factor that forms extensive associations with the branch site-3' splice site-3' exon region upon prespliceosome formation; similarity to the mammalian U2 snRNP-associated splicing factor SAP155[1][2][3]
